> I’m happy to see usage of PlatformLogger being converted to System.Logger.
>
> Is there any reason why Log can’t be a concrete implementation class?

It could but it would still be a bit artificial and would add an
extra call layer in the call stack. I considered it but opted for
the simpler solution.

> Can it extends SimpleConsoleLogger instead?

No. SimpleConsoleLogger is designed to be a 'terminal' logger
(I mean - not a wrapper) that publishes on System.err.
(+ it would require a qualified export from java.base)
